This text is the successor to Tulchin's "Problems in Latin American History", which was published in the 1970s and has been out of print for ten years. Realising how the field has changed, Professors Chasteen and Tulchin have compiled a work that addresses new topics and issues to serve scholars, students and general readers. The editors have demarcated nine "problems" in modern Latin America. Each of the book's nine chapters, compiled by an expert in the field, begins with an introduction that provides an overview of the "problem" to be examined. This is followed by related selections by both historians and the makers of history.
